Instead of call PCCreate(PETSC_COMM_WORLD, pc, ierr) call PCSetType(pc, PCILU,ierr) ! Choose a preconditioner type (ILU) call KSPSetPC(ksp, pc,ierr) ! Associate the preconditioner with the KSP solver do call KSPGetPC(ksp,pc,ierr) call PCSetType(pc, PCILU,ierr) Do not call KSPSetUp(). It will be taken care of automatically during the solve

[EXTERNAL EMAIL] I am guessing that you are creating a matrix, adding to it, finalizing it ("assembly"), and then adding to it again, which is fine, but you are adding new non-zeros to the sparsity pattern. If this is what you want then you can tell the matrix to let you do that. Otherwise you have a bug.
